Can start with a simple piece of dna and make billions of copies. Dna template reverse transcribed))- 100 bp to thousands. Can be double or single stranded (genomic dna or cdna (made when a mrna is dntp datp, dttp, dgtp, dctp. Taq dna polymerase (isolated from microbe thermus aquaticus) Proper concentration is crucial- too little = inactive, too much = unstable.
